Delhi is the capital city of India. Major attractions to see in this city include Red Fort (world heritage site), Jama Masjid (the largest mosque of India), Chandani Chowk, Rajghat (the final resting place of Mahatma Gandhi), Qutub Minar (the world's largest brick minaret and world heritage site), Humayun's Tomb (world heritage site), India Gate (all India war memorial), President House, Parliament House, Lotus Temple, Laxmi Narayan Mandir, Akshardham Temple (the largest Hindu temple complex in the world), etc. There are many more in this city. In fact, the list is unending.

Agra is a historical city located in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. It is the central attraction of golden triangle trip in India. To fascinate travelers the city has lots to offer. There are some magnificent heritage and historical places in this city which shall fascinate tourists. Among most famous sites in the city include Taj Mahal (one of Seven Wonders of the World and a UNESCO world heritage site), Agra Fort (UNESCO world heritage site), Itmad-ud-Daulah Tomb, Dayalbagh, Mehtab Bagh, Chini-Ka-Rauza, Sikandara Akbar's Tomb, Buland Darwaza (the largest gateway in the world) and Fatehpur Sikri (world heritage site).

Jaipur, the capital and largest city of Rajasthan, is the third destination of Golden triangle tour packages in India. Famed as the Pink City of India or Gem City, it is also the first planned city of India. The glory of this charming city can be experienced in its magnificent forts, palaces, temples and other attractions. Major attractions to see in this city include City Palace Complex, Hawa Mahal, Jal Mahal, Jantar Mantar, Albert Hall Museum, Nahargarh Fort, Jaigarh Fort and Amber Fort.

One of the major landmarks out of these is the Hawa Mahal.

Hawa Mahal is one of the most historic and an attractive monument in Jaipur. It is located next to city palace. This beautiful fort was built by Maharaja Sawai Pratap Singh in the year 1799 that makes this monument over 200 years old. It was designed by Lal Chand Utsa and was dedicated by him, to Lord Krishan and Radha. The main beauty of this palace is its architecture that is of Rajputana style with a perfect blend of Mughal architecture.

It is the most popular site for tourist attraction in Jaipur. This palace in Jaipur is such that it gives the onlookers a spectacular view. The architecture is a true reflection of royal lifestyle of the kings of that time.

The literal meaning of the palace is the ‘palace of winds'. The shape is that of a pyramid or you can say that its shape like the crown of lord Krishna and it is as high as five stories, has 953 small windows all of which are highlighted with web work. The common name given to these windows is ‘jarokha' and has an appearance of a honeycomb. Through the windows, a cool breeze circulates all through the palace and keeps the whole place, cool. Even during the summer season. Along with the 953 windows, the Hawa Mahal also has small balconies.

The structure of Hawa Mahal is fantastic and appeals to be imperial. It is a splendid beauty having Mughal architecture and sometimes owes it similarity to the Panch-Mahal at Fatehpur Sikri. The architecture is solid and a mystical example of romance. To reach the upper floor levels, there are no stores and only ramps.

Taj Mahal: - This mausoleum of undying love was built in the mid 17th century by Emperor Shah Jahan in the memory of Queen Mumtaz. The shrine of true love is a world UNESCO heritage site and is one of the seventh wonder of the world. The structural wonder is the esteem architectural creation of Mughals, which display the most aesthetic work of Indo-Islamic designs. The outing of India is said to be unfinished without a visit to the Taj Mahal.
Agra Fort: - The monument won the most prestigious Aga Khan Award for architecture in 2004 and is an UNESCO world heritage site strategically positioned on the bank of river Yamuna. The fortress was the domicile to the dominant Mughal clan and the entire nation was controlled from here.
Fatehpur Sikri: - The city was constructed by Emperor Akbar in the year 1570 to tribute the Sufi Saint Shaikh Salim Chisti who predicted the birth of his son. The holy shrine earlier known as Fatehabad was declared a UESCO heritage site in the year 1986. Fatehpur Sikri popularly known as ghost city is located at a distance of 39 Kms from Agra and is well connected to every corner of the country.
The other Mughal architectural epitomes are Itmadh-Ud-Daulah Tomb, Jama Maszid, Sikandra and many more. Apart from the monuments, the annual cultural celebration that takes place from February 18th to February 27th is famed as Taj Mahotsav. The festival is all about the celebration of the affluent legacy of astonishing India amidst culture, art, sculpture, folk dances, songs, cuisines, handicrafts, and literature.
